Transaction 9542433491a2f414b574528a4e62d904337ee1b59c38b11bb99bf51c63a2454c

1 Input
2 Outputs
  • 9542433491a2f414b574528a4e62d904337ee1b59c38b11bb99bf51c63a2454c:0
  • value  32345811
    address  3F3Bt4hw1AqLGSYFXd2DuRJReRk3hWbtQN
  • 9542433491a2f414b574528a4e62d904337ee1b59c38b11bb99bf51c63a2454c:1
  • value  5786506890
    address  3NWndKFmvV6cJ6ENgXVeaDTo3mBfAvr27H